Excel 转 JSON by WTSolutions API 文档

简介

Excel 转 JSON API 提供了一种简单的方式将 Excel 和 CSV 数据转换为 JSON 格式。该 API 接受制表符分隔或逗号分隔的文本数据,并返回结构化的 JSON。

接口端点

POST mcp.wtsolutions.cn/excel-to-js...

请求格式

API 接受包含以下参数的 JSON 格式 POST 请求:

参数 类型 是否必填 描述
data string 制表符分隔或逗号分隔的文本数据,至少包含两行(标题行 + 数据行)

请求示例

json 复制代码
{
  "data": "姓名\t年龄\t是否学生\n张三\t25\tfalse\n李四\t30\ttrue"
}

响应格式

API 返回包含以下结构的 JSON 对象:

字段 类型 描述
isError boolean 指示处理请求时是否发生错误
msg string 状态消息或错误描述
data array/object/null 转换后的 JSON 数据(发生错误时为 null)

成功响应示例

json 复制代码
{
  "isError": false,
  "msg": "success",
  "data": [
    {
      "姓名": "张三",
      "年龄": 25,
      "是否学生": false
    },
    {
      "姓名": "李四",
      "年龄": 30,
      "是否学生": true
    }
  ]
}

错误响应示例

json 复制代码
{
  "isError": true,
  "msg": "Excel 数据至少需要 2 行",
  "data": null
}

数据类型处理

API 会自动检测并转换不同的数据类型:

  • 数字:转换为数值类型
  • 布尔值:识别 'true'/'false'(不区分大小写)并转换为布尔值
  • 日期:检测各种日期格式并适当转换
  • 字符串:视为字符串值
  • 空值:表示为空字符串

错误处理

API 针对常见问题返回描述性错误消息:

  • Excel Data Format Invalid:当输入数据不是制表符分隔或逗号分隔时
  • At least 2 rows are required:当输入数据少于 2 行时
  • Blank/Null/Empty cells in the first row not allowed:当标题行包含空单元格时
  • Server Internal Error:发生意外错误时

价格

目前免费。

捐赠

buymeacoffee.com/wtsolutions

相关推荐
我叫黑大帅16 分钟前
前端如何竖屏固定视口背景
前端·javascript·面试
不会敲代码137 分钟前
我花了三天时间,终于把 Cookie、XSS、CSRF 和浏览器存储给整明白了
javascript·面试
贩卖黄昏的熊44 分钟前
flex 布局快速梳理
开发语言·javascript·css3·html5
swipe1 小时前
Mem0 x Agent 实战系列:分层记忆 + 三路召回,搭建真正可用的长期记忆层
前端·javascript·面试
kyriewen1 小时前
手写 call、apply、bind:从原理到实现,附 3 个最容易忽略的边界情况
前端·javascript·面试
胡萝卜术1 小时前
从内存视角重新认识 JavaScript 数据类型:一份深度学习笔记
前端·javascript·面试
LiuJun2Son2 小时前
Angular 快速入门:从零搭建你的第一个应用
前端·javascript·angular.js
烬羽2 小时前
从零理解树与二叉树:用 JS 带你手撕遍历和递归
javascript·数据结构
YHL2 小时前
🚀从零理解树与二叉树 —— 概念、实现与遍历
前端·javascript·数据结构
十九画生2 小时前
学 JavaScript 数据类型,真正要搞懂的是:变量里存的到底是什么?
javascript